Core i7-8750H vs Core i7-5500U specs and performance

In our benchmarks, the Core i7-8750H beats the Core i7-5500U in overall performance. Furthermore, our gaming benchmark shows that it also outperforms the Core i7-5500U in all gaming tests too.

In terms of the number of cores of each of these CPUs, the Core i7-8750H has significantly more cores than the Core i7-5500U. Indeed, the Core i7-8750H has 6 cores compared to 2 cores found in the Core i7-5500U. It also has more threads than the Core i7-5500U. These CPUs have different clock speeds. Indeed, the Core i7-5500U has a slightly higher clock speed compared to the Core i7-8750H. Despite this, the Core i7-8750H has a slightly higher turbo speed. The Core i7-5500U outputs less heat than Core i7-8750H thanks to a significantly lower TDP. This measures the amount of heat they output and can be used to estimate power consumption. In terms of cache, the Core i7-8750H has significantly more L2 cache when compared to the Core i7-5500U. The Core i7-8750H also has significantly more L3 cache.

Most CPUs have more threads than cores. This technology, colloquially called hyperthreading, improves performance by splitting a core into multiple virtual ones. This provides more efficient utilisation of a core. Indeed, the Core i7-8750H has more threads than cores. Each physical core is split into multiple threads.
